Better thumbs
When we started, we were using thumbshots.org, which seemed to be the best solution for our thumbs (and not to mention it was free). After a few months we realized that this has some limitations:
- fixed size of the thumbs,
- the thumb was taken a long time ago (maybe even years ago, depending on the age of the domain) and no longer accurately represents the image of the site.
We wanted to have something that shows users a recent quick look of how the blogs look rather than an archaic one. Also we wanted to make it easy for our members to easily refresh their own thumbs at anytime.
We found the perfect solution for our needs in Bluga.net WebThumb, a service that had all the requirements we needed and much more. This is not a free service, but we believe it is worth the money. As of today we have launched all the thumbs with the new format. Each blog has saved several sizes of its thumb and they can be seen on different parts of our site already (medium – blog rankings, large – sitedetails, etc.).
